Activity Cost Drivers
Factors that influence the costs of business activities, often used in activity-based costing to allocate costs more accurately.
ABC Costing System
Activity Based Costing system; a method of cost accounting that identifies and assigns costs to specific activities involved in the production process to better understand overhead costs.
Plantwide Overhead Rate
A single overhead absorption rate used throughout an entire plant or company to allocate indirect costs to products.
Overhead Rate Methods
Different methodologies used to allocate overhead costs to products or services based on criteria such as direct labor hours, machine hours, or direct material costs.
